Mesquite trees grow brand-new branches rapidly, and mature trees call for annual trimming. Leaners have to maintain some arm or legs in the lower, middle, and upper tree canopy to keep its health and wellness.

Prune crepe myrtles prior to new leaves start growing in very early spring. Cutting off the top of crepe myrtles makes them prone to conditions. Tree pruning sets you back $200 to $800 generally or approximately $1,600 for huge trees. The cost to weaken trees enhances if it's close to a structure or various other barriers.

Trimming assists fruit trees expand much healthier and generate more fruit. Do not remove even more than 20% to 30% of the tree each year because severe trimming compromises the plant.

Heritage trees Certain regulations and licenses are essential to trim secured trees. Hefty machinery Crane-assisted tree trimming costs $500 to $2,500 per day extra for the added transportation, insurance coverage, driver, and gas.

Cutting the complete a healthy tree is not a certified pruning method for promoting development. Crown reduction costs $250 to $1,300. The price to reduce back trees with this technique is greater than trimming since it calls for even more planning and knowledge. Hire an arborist instead of a standard tree trimmer if: The tree requires therapies for conditions or bugs. The city requires an arborist's record for functioning with safeguarded trees.

Younger trees require cutting every 2 to 3 years. Trimming when the tree is dormant in cold climate minimizes threats of insects or conditions attacking the tree.

Look for skilled companies with ISA-certified arborists. Read their evaluations on HomeGuide and Google. Request a thorough bid and duplicates of the agreement and service warranty. Be cautious of the cheapest quotes that can suggest low-grade work. Never pay completely in advance. Do not work with business that cover trees, reducing all big branches to the stubs.
